Alan S Kim, the child actor from Minari, and Eighth Grade star Elsie Fisher will be starring in the upcoming movie, Latchkey Kids.

John J Budion will direct the dark comedy from a script by Meaghan Cleary.

The story is about Shae (Kim), a bright nine-year-old boy, who befriends an eccentric teenage girl (Fisher) looking to escape the troubling life that her mother has created for her, all the while the local enforcement believe the boy might be offing his babysitters.

Ken H Keller and Caron Rudner will produce the feature, while Brendan Thomas, Cory Thompson, David Polemeni and Donald Malter will serve as executive producers.

Production of Latchkey Kids will start in June this year.
